Eye Candy of the day: Cai Guo-Qiang

Cai Guo-Qiang, China born contemporary artist is known for blowing up the scene his use of explosives and fireworks to create breathtaking visuals.

A Mid-Career retrospective is going on at the Guggenheim starting Feb 22nd.  More after the break..
